The pdp candidate Gen charlse Arhiavbere has already filed a petition challenging the re-election of d ACN gov Adams at the tribunal sitting at the state high court complex,benin city. Pdp has dissassociate itself from the petition leaving the general to his own faith. Gen. Charlse is on his own. The general stil have this millitary orientation of no retreat,no surrender. he should have used money he wants to spend to pursue the case to assist the less priviledge and the poor.
